Comprehending Car Diagnostics
In today's auto landscape, an extensive understanding of vehicle diagnostics is important for effective automobile fixing and maintenance. Vehicle diagnostics encompasses a variety of techniques and devices used to determine and analyze car efficiency concerns. This procedure generally entails making use of specific tools to retrieve data from the automobile's onboard computer system systems, which keep an eye on numerous components including the engine, transmission, and discharges systems.
Modern lorries are equipped with sophisticated analysis capacities that can reveal fault codes, sensor readings, and system conditions. Professionals use these diagnostics to identify problems that might not be immediately visible through conventional examination methods. An accurate diagnosis forms the foundation for any type of repair work procedure, permitting targeted treatments as opposed to uncertainty, which can bring about unneeded fixings and increased expenses.
Comprehending the concepts of automobile diagnostics likewise involves knowledge with the different analysis tools offered, including OBD-II scanners, multimeters, and oscilloscopes. Mastery of these tools allows service technicians to translate data efficiently and apply their searchings for to recover car capability. As vehicle innovation remains to evolve, remaining educated regarding the most recent diagnostic methodologies and devices is necessary for vehicle experts seeking to supply top notch service.

Usual Problems Identified
Regularly come across issues advance auto collision in vehicle fixing diagnostics consist of issues with the ignition system, gas shipment, and electrical elements. Ignition system failures usually manifest as engine misfires or failure to start, frequently due to damaged ignition system, ignition coils, or timing issues. These problems can severely influence engine performance and gas efficiency.
Gas delivery problems, such as clogged up fuel filters or failing gas pumps, can lead to insufficient gas reaching the engine, causing poor acceleration and delaying. Diagnostics in these situations concentrate on fuel pressure examinations and analyzing gas injectors to make certain proper performance.
Electrical elements are an additional frequent source of analysis obstacles. Defective circuitry, blown fuses, or malfunctioning sensors can impede lorry their explanation operations, causing control panel caution lights or erratic efficiency. Professionals frequently use multimeters and analysis scanners to determine electric mistakes accurately.
